Output 1fee93093a73503bcda18f0855b0d01b435fe27641e1a296b3609d7c73fffcc4:45

value
44060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4315fc905168d2309d341ed2234bd79ada126a3e OP_EQUAL
address
37ojY3tJtkvcqQfYJz4qPRZ4HQ5qLXBq2U
transaction
1fee93093a73503bcda18f0855b0d01b435fe27641e1a296b3609d7c73fffcc4
confirmations
183536
spent
true